45 The pots, the shovels, and the basins—all these vessels that Hiram made for King Solomon for the house of the Lord were of burnished bronze.(A) 46 In the plain of the Jordan the king cast them, in the clay ground between Succoth and Zarethan.(B) 47 Solomon left all the vessels unweighed because there were so many of them; the weight of the bronze was not determined.
